Complete the slope-intercept form equation of the line with slope − 8 that passes through the point (0,−2)(0,−2).

<span>Complete the slope-intercept form equation of the line with slope − 8 that passes through the point (0,−2)    (don't mention (0,-2) more than once)

y = mx + b, with m= -8, comes out to y = -8x + b.

Subst. 0 for x and -2 for y and then calculate b:  -2 = 0 + b => b = -2

Then the equation is y = -8x - 2.</span>

Write an equation of the line passing through point (7,3) that is parallel to line 4x-7y=9
Genrish500 [490]

Answer:

y= 4/7x -1  

Step-by-step explanation:

solve for y first in 4x-7y=9, which becomes y = 4/7x - 9/7, then since its a parallel line the slope stays the same which is 4/7. Then plug into this equation: y =mx+b, in which you plug in the point for the x and y values and you plug in the slope for m, so the equation becomes, 3 = (7)(4/7) + b and now solve for b in which b = -1 and now write the equation using all the corresponding things so the equation becomes: y= 4/7x -1
